Oatley Lions Club Pink Quilt Competition

Mr MARK COURE (Oatley) (13:30:55):

Last month Oatley Cottage and Oatley Lions Club held a Pink Quilt Competition and exhibition at Oatley Uniting Church. The aim of the competition was to raise much‑needed money for the McGrath Foundation to place specialist McGrath Breast Care Nurses wherever they are needed and to make understanding breast health a priority. On the day a total of $7,700 was raised, with additional funding going to the foundation after all quilts had been sold. The gracious winner of the competition, who was rewarded with a sewing machine package valued at $1,000, decided to donate it back to Oatley Cottage to sell, contributing an additional $1,000 to the total amount. I congratulate all participants in the Pink Quilt Competition who committed their time, money and resources to contribute to a great exhibition. I also recognise all of the volunteers who were actively involved in making the event such a success. The partnership between Oatley Cottage and Oatley Lions Club is commendable and I am thrilled that so much awareness and money was raised for such a worthy cause.
